Seaford Car Crash Leads to DSP Homicide Investigation

SEAFORD, Del. – The Delaware State Police (DSP) are investigating  a homicide that occurred in Seaford on Thursday.

On May 21, around 8:45 p.m., troopers responded to the 24000 block of German Road for a reported crash. When troopers arrived, they found the driver of the vehicle, a 17-year-old male from Laurel, with an apparent gunshot wound and began lifesaving efforts. The teenage victim was taken to an area hospital, where he died from his injuries. His identity is being withheld until his family is notified.

Due to the nature of the incident, the DSP Homicide Unit assumed the investigation. Preliminarily, detectives say they have learned that the victim was shot near the Concord Pond boat ramp on German Road by an unknown suspect.
